Description

No.GradeFeature and Property1

HH-650 Bimtetal Chromium Carbide Overlay Weld Wear Resistant steel Plate

C:4.3-4.8%, Cr:20-26%,

Heat resistance maximum up to 350 ºC. Hardness: 57-62 HRC

2HH-700B Bimtetal Chromium Carbide Overlay Weld Wear Resistant steel Plate

C:4.3-5.0%, Cr:23-28%,

Heat resistance maximum up to 500 ºC. Hardness: 57-62 HRC

3HH-750A Bimtetal Chromium Carbide Overlay Weld Wear Resistant steel Plate

C:4.3-5.0%, Cr:27-35%,

Heat resistance maximum up to 500 ºC. Hardness: 58-63 HRC

Other Feature and Property

1. Chemical composition: Bimtetal Chromium Carbide Overlay Weld Wear Resistant steel Plates are manufactured by welding one or multiple abrasion resistant layers on Mild steel (Q235, Q345) or stainless steel (SS 304, SS 309, SS 310) base plate.

2. The overlay alloy has a high amount of chromium carbide hard particles.

3. Microstructure: The carbide (Cr7C3) volum fraction on the microstructure is above 50%.

4. Rockwell Hardness: Chromium carbide hard particles are distributed evenly throughout the layer, creating a strong microstructure,

5. The hardness is between HRC 57-62 and depend on the overlay's thickness: Overlay thickness over 10 mm. Hardness over 62 HRC.

6. Wear resistance: Our test shows that the Abrasion resistant performance of Bimtetal Chromium Carbide Overlay Weld Wear Resistant steel Plate is 20 times higher than Mild steel and 8 times than heat treated steel.

7. Flatness tolerance: Flatness tolerance is ±3mm/m.

8. Thickness tolerance: Uniform overlay thickness, with tolerance within 0-0.3mm.
